The National Executive Council(NEC) of the Niger Delta Students Union Government (NIDSUG), led by the National President, Comrade Scot Ogunseri, alongside National Association of Nigerian Students (NANS) national delegates paid an official courtesy visit to Mr. Abba Abubakar Aliya Managing Director/Chief Executive Officer(MD/CEO) of the Rural Electrification Agency (REA) at the Agency’s Head Office in Abuja.
During the interactive session, the MD/CEO warmly received the delegation
and disclosed ongoing and future initiatives of the Agency. He highlighted the provision of mini-grids and solar lighting systems to institutions across the Niger Delta region, as well as the commencement of the third phase of REA’s programme, which will further extend access to clean and sustainable energy in underserved communities.
Significantly, the MD/CEO also announced the appointment of a Students Desk Officer, to ensure effective engagement and representation of student interests in the Agency’s programmes.
In response, the delegation, under the leadership of Comrade Ogunseri, commended the MD/CEO for his visionary leadership and reaffirmed their appreciation to President Bola Ahmed Tinubu, for the Federal Government’s laudable reforms and continued support towards infrastructural and educational development in the Niger Delta region.
The students’ body expressed optimism that these interventions will not only improve access to energy but also foster academic excellence, youth empowerment, and regional development.
